AD
Visakhapatnam, Andhra Pradesh, India
MN
D2a Corporate Services Private Limited
BP
Markdigi Digital Solutions Andconsultancy Services Private Limited
RS
Ii2a Global Corporate Services Private Limited
VD
Based on most searched companies on The Company Check.
OTHER BUSINESS ACTIVITIES